| +IN_PROC_BROWSER_TEST_F(PeripheralBatteryObserverTest, Basic) {
|
| + base::SimpleTestTickClock clock;
|
| + observer_->set_testing_clock(&clock);
|
| +
|
| + NotificationUIManager* notification_manager =
|
| + g_browser_process->notification_ui_manager();
|
| +
|
| + // Level 50 at time 100, no low-battery notification.
|
| + clock.Advance(base::TimeDelta::FromSeconds(100));
|
| + observer_->PeripheralBatteryStatusReceived(kTestBatteryPath,
|
| + kTestDeviceName, 50);
|
| + EXPECT_EQ(observer_->batteries_.count(kTestBatteryAddress), 1u);
|
| +
|
| + const PeripheralBatteryObserver::BatteryInfo& info =
|
| + observer_->batteries_[kTestBatteryAddress];
|
| +
|
| + EXPECT_EQ(info.name, kTestDeviceName);
|
| + EXPECT_EQ(info.level, 50);
|
| + EXPECT_EQ(info.last_notification_timestamp, base::TimeTicks());
|
| + EXPECT_FALSE(notification_manager->DoesIdExist(kTestBatteryAddress));
|
| +
|
| + // Level 5 at time 110, low-battery notification.
|
| + clock.Advance(base::TimeDelta::FromSeconds(10));
|
| + observer_->PeripheralBatteryStatusReceived(kTestBatteryPath,
|
| + kTestDeviceName, 5);
|
| + EXPECT_EQ(info.level, 5);
|
| + EXPECT_EQ(info.last_notification_timestamp, clock.NowTicks());
|
| + EXPECT_TRUE(notification_manager->DoesIdExist(kTestBatteryAddress));
|
| +
|
| + // Level -1 at time 115, cancel previous notification
|
| + clock.Advance(base::TimeDelta::FromSeconds(5));
|
| + observer_->PeripheralBatteryStatusReceived(kTestBatteryPath,
|
| + kTestDeviceName, -1);
|
| + EXPECT_EQ(info.level, 5);
|
| + EXPECT_EQ(info.last_notification_timestamp,
|
| + clock.NowTicks() - base::TimeDelta::FromSeconds(5));
|
| + EXPECT_FALSE(notification_manager->DoesIdExist(kTestBatteryAddress));
|
| +
|
| + // Level 50 at time 120, no low-battery notification.
|
| + clock.Advance(base::TimeDelta::FromSeconds(5));
|
| + observer_->PeripheralBatteryStatusReceived(kTestBatteryPath,
|
| + kTestDeviceName, 50);
|
| + EXPECT_EQ(info.level, 50);
|
| + EXPECT_EQ(info.last_notification_timestamp,
|
| + clock.NowTicks() - base::TimeDelta::FromSeconds(10));
|
| + EXPECT_FALSE(notification_manager->DoesIdExist(kTestBatteryAddress));
|
| +
|
| + // Level 5 at time 130, no low-battery notification (throttling).
|
| + clock.Advance(base::TimeDelta::FromSeconds(10));
|
| + observer_->PeripheralBatteryStatusReceived(kTestBatteryPath,
|
| + kTestDeviceName, 5);
|
| + EXPECT_EQ(info.level, 5);
|
| + EXPECT_EQ(info.last_notification_timestamp,
|
| + clock.NowTicks() - base::TimeDelta::FromSeconds(20));
|
| + EXPECT_FALSE(notification_manager->DoesIdExist(kTestBatteryAddress));
|
| +}
